WinLab Image Laboratory V3.0
Copyright (c) 1993,1994 PhD Engineering SRL
WinLab is a powerful Image Processing tools able to satisfy the needs of both
inexperienced and advanced users. Besides the opportunity of managing a
number of different image formats, including the JPEG compression standard,
WinLab also offers a wide choice of advanced processing tools.
WinLab supports any kind of image format up to 24 bpp full color images,
8 bpp grayscale,256 colors.
WinLab can perform:
color correction/calibration, color format conversion (HSL, HSV, YUV, YIQ,
CMYK, etc), on-line color palette changes (loading, saving), histogram
equalization stretching specification, contrast/intensity change (many
color spaces), resizing, rotation, zooming, color dithering (many algorithms),
bit per pixel conversion, color channels split/merge (many color spaces),
filtering (user defined masks, low/high pass, crispening, blurring,
directional, autoregressive, edge preserving, etc), noise addition (gaussian,
uniform), edge detection (many), edge thinning, segmentation, classification,
image operations (add,sub,blend, etc), image masking, and many others.
WinLab fully supports floating selection inside images (rectangular,elliptical,
segment/freehand, magic wande), each operation is transparently applied to the
whole image or to the selection if any.
WinLab has supports tools bars for fast command access and floating selection
operations.
The speed aspects have been carefully taken into account during the
implementation of every WinLab module, from the access to image data to the
more complex processing tools.
Many instruments have been introduced to improve the accessibility to the
system functionalities even to less experienced users
The processing tools have been designed to have good performances in terms of
speed/accurateness.
The interface of WinLab has been designed in order to be easy-to-use,
configurable, ergonomic, compliant to windows standard.
The introduction of image folders gives the possibility to easily manage and
access collections of images in different formats and in different places by
an immediate and transparent interface.
WinLab has a built-in network support (any NETBIOS compatible layer) for
folders, which enables to share images over a LAN in a transparent way,
moreover you can send and receive an image or a folder through the use of the
netproto.exe DDE server which is a window socket compliant application.
WinLab rely on the PhD TWAIN DDE server to fully support TWAIN compliant source
handling, enabling image acquisition from any kind of device which is TWAIN
compatible.
